Devin O What is the benefit to attaching a reel? is it necessary?
BARRY A usually only snorkelers or free-divers use a reel so that you can get back to the surface if you hit a big fish that wants to take you for a ride.

Kristy B Would this gun be good for a first timer?
CHARLES T Its the perfect gun for first timer. It is very light accurate and easy to load. I own a charter dive boat, and have friends that have bought bigger guns to start out, and they all ended up buying this gun or one similar after seeing the ease of use. This gun is however primarily good for reef hunting, if your looking to do some open water or blue water hunting you may require something a bit bigger for the range. Best of luck

Whats in the box:Spear Gun, Shaft JBL742S, Slings Two JBL224, Spear Point JBL847, Shock Line JBL515L If you're looking for a spear gun that's big on performance while still leaving a little green in your wallet, the Explorer is perfect. Made with a corrosion resistant hardened 17-4 stainless steel trigger and shaft, JBL742S shaft is 42" (107 cm) and is 5/16" in diameter, cast aluminum, two piece handle, and combinedwith a 1" (2.5 cm) aerospace alloy barrel for quick target acquisition and fatalresults. Guns overall length is 53" (135 cm). Same parallel power source and lowprofile design make the Explorer perfect for cagy fish when the shot window is asplit second. The Two JBL224 slings are a unique latex formulation and dip manufacturing process that delivers radical modulus strength. The power curve increases as bands are stretched for optimum performance. Special anti-oxidants help protect against harmful U.V. rays, prolonging slings life. The slings wishbones are 302 stainless wires that provide superior strength and durability. The JBL847 Twin Barbed Rock Point is an economical multi-purpose point. Double 2-5/8" wing span design increases holding power. Wing retainer allows for easy removal of fish. Tip is designed for medium to small fish. Gun is equipped with the JBL515L Shock Line. Sometimes we miss or we shoot a large fish and the recoil can pull the gun out of your grip, which ever the shock line will keep you in control.
